On July 17, 1955, Walt Disney opened the gates of his greatest dream. After an entire year of hearing about this magic kingdom, guests finally got a chance to see this place. Hosted by Art Linkletter, Bob Cummings, Ronald Reagan, and Walt Disney, the opening day festivities featured the Mouseketeers, Fess Parker as Davy Crockett, Guy Williams as Zorro, Mickey Mouse, and many other guests, which came to hear Walt Disney say those famous words, "To all who come to this happy place, WELCOME!" But, contrary to popular belief, it did not all start with a mouse. According to Walt, "It all started with a daddy with two daughters wondering where he could take them where he could have a little fun, too."
